+# Microsoft Azure ContainerServiceFleet management client library for .NET
+
+**[Describe the service briefly first.]**
+
+This library follows the [new Azure SDK guidelines](https://azure.github.io/azure-sdk/general_introduction.html), and provides many core capabilities:
+
+ - Support MSAL.NET, Azure.Identity is out of box for supporting MSAL.NET.
+ - Support [OpenTelemetry](https://opentelemetry.io/) for distributed tracing.
+ - HTTP pipeline with custom policies.
+ - Better error-handling.
+ - Support uniform telemetry across all languages.
+
+## Getting started
+
+### Install the package
+
+Install the Microsoft Azure ContainerServiceFleet management library for .NET with [NuGet](https://www.nuget.org/):
+
+```dotnetcli
+dotnet add package Azure.ResourceManager.ContainerServiceFleet --prerelease
+```
+
+### Prerequisites
+
+* You must have an [Microsoft Azure subscription](https://azure.microsoft.com/free/dotnet/).
+
+### Authenticate the Client
+
+To create an authenticated client and start interacting with Microsoft Azure resources, see the [quickstart guide here](https://github.com/Azure/azure-sdk-for-net/blob/main/doc/dev/mgmt_quickstart.md).
+
+## Key concepts
+
+Key concepts of the Microsoft Azure SDK for .NET can be found [here](https://azure.github.io/azure-sdk/dotnet_introduction.html)
+
+## Documentation
+
+Documentation is available to help you learn how to use this package:
+
+- [Quickstart](https://github.com/Azure/azure-sdk-for-net/blob/main/doc/dev/mgmt_quickstart.md).
+- [API References](https://learn.microsoft.com/dotnet/api/?view=azure-dotnet).
+- [Authentication](https://github.com/Azure/azure-sdk-for-net/blob/main/sdk/identity/Azure.Identity/README.md).
+
+## Examples
+
+Code samples for using the management library for .NET can be found in the following locations
+- [.NET Management Library Code Samples](https://aka.ms/azuresdk-net-mgmt-samples)
+
+## Troubleshooting
+
+- File an issue via [GitHub Issues](https://github.com/Azure/azure-sdk-for-net/issues).
+- Check [previous questions](https://stackoverflow.com/questions/tagged/azure+.net) or ask new ones on Stack Overflow using Azure and .NET tags.
+
+## Next steps
+
+For more information about Microsoft Azure SDK, see [this website](https://azure.github.io/azure-sdk/).
